Fishing Line November 27

IN a week that was dominated by the weather, there was still some great fishing at Swanswater. Due to over three inches of rain in 36 hours, the water level at the end of the week was the highest ever seen, and the main pond was unfishable on Thursday and on Friday morning. Fortunately there was no lasting damage and the level dropped fairly quickly so fishing was possible by around 11amFriday. Some of the bigger fish were moving around this week and a good number in the 5lb to 9lb range were landed. The fish are still not deep and taking a variety of flies including Damsel, particularly hot-heads, Dancer, Ace of Spades, Daiwl Bach, Buzzer and various colours of Fritz.Read
